The MIC top sucks. I think many of us are planning to go soft top and then fork out the ~4K for the modular once it's available. I'd like to have a soft top for summer, so the cost makes sense.
My main concern is if you order your bronco with a soft top, does the car still come with the washer/electrical hookups needed for the hard top? or will that be another additional cost when you go to install your modular top later? Anyone able to confirm?
I asked this in another thread but it got lost, and I figured this is pretty relevant info. If it doesn't have the hookups that would be pretty strange, but I haven't seen any pictures of the trunk of a soft top bronco...
The ones I have seen with the hard top removed show the cables are exposed in the trunk and plugged into dummy connectors. That'd be pretty annoying if you only have a soft top and have no need for them...
